The individual in this role will have responsibility for leading and developing the Shared R&D Engineering function at the Medtronic site in Parkmore, supporting the CRDN, CRM, CAS, PVH, SH&A and Neuromodulation OU's, This individual will develop and lead the Shared site R&D engineering team and will manage and develop the shared engineering infrastructure at the Medtronic Parkmore site, to support New Product Development and the Customer Innovation Centre. The individual will be expected to collaborate with and support all OU's and cross-functional groups conducting New Pro
duct Development and Customer engagement activity at the site. This role will report directly to the R&D Director in the CRDN OU. This individual will create a culture of technical and professional growth, as well as demonstrating world class execution of projects and Customer engagement activity through their team and through collaboration with the various cross functional stakeholders across multiple OU's.
